Problem

Achieving precise ride height adjustments in vehicles during manufacturing is challenging, often requiring replacement of components and resulting in waste, as existing methods are inefficient and wasteful.

Innovation Solution

A height adjustable top mount system comprising a top plate, worm wheel, core, and worm gear that allows for vertical movement of the top plate relative to the core, enabling ride height adjustments without replacing components, using a worm gear to drive the worm wheel and adjust the ride height by rotating the top plate.

AI summary

A height adjustable top mount for adjusting a ride height of a vehicle comprising includes a top plate, a worm wheel, a core, and worm gear. The top plate is configured to mount to a body of the vehicle and movable between a first position and a second position. The worm wheel is received in the top plate and includes an inner wheel surface and an outer wheel surface. The core is received within the worm wheel and helically meshed to the inner wheel surface of the worm wheel. The worm gear is meshed to the outer wheel surface of the worm wheel. Rotation of the worm gear drives rotation of the worm wheel, rotation of the worm wheel simultaneously moves the top plate vertically relative to the core, and movement of the top plate adjusts the ride height of the vehicle in a corresponding direction.
